61 Outputs

The LM-CIRIA control unit allows for outputs to be easily addressed and re-grouped and for their
addresses to be easily checked.

611 Addressing

Path: SERVICE MENU / EXTERNAL / ASSIGN ADDRESS / OUTPUTS
Figure 143: OUTPUTS settings level
– Start point: OUTPUTS settings level
= The room address (ROOM) is displayed in the header.
= On/off key LED illuminates.
Note
• If there are DALI operating devices in the system without a DALI short address, they will first be au-
tomatically assigned a DALI short address. This automatic addressing occurs before the addressing
described here and is displayed in the touchscreen header as DALI INIT. The automatic assignment
of the DALI short address may take several minutes depending on the number of DALI operating
devices.
1.
Select TYPE to choose the building service type for the unaddressed output.
= TYPE illuminates.
2.
Run your finger along the touchring until the desired setting appears.
3.
Remove your finger from the touchring.
= BUS ADDR. illuminates.
= An available bus address is displayed.
= The output to be addressed responds (e.g. luminaire brightens to 100%).
= The output's production number (P:) appears in the header.
4.
Run your finger along the touchring until the desired bus address appears.
5.
Select GROUP.
= GROUP illuminates.
6.
Run your finger along the touchring until the desired group address appears.
7.
Press the on/off key to save the settings.
= The message SAVED briefly appears.
= Room, group and bus addresses are saved for the output.
= The next unaddressed output of the same building service type responds.
8.
Select NEXT if you do not wish to address this output.
